The Los Angeles Lakers were already without LeBron James against the San Antonio Spurs due to an ankle injury. Now they've been dealt with another injury scare on co-star Anthony Davis.

The Lakers big man was seen writhing in pain during the final minute of regulation against the Spurs. Anthony Davis was positioning himself for a rebound but landed awkwardly on his right leg, leaving him in a heap on the baseline.

Lakers fans can breath a sigh of relief for the time being as AD stayed in the contest as it went to overtime. He even jumped for the tip, which is a good sign that his knee isn't bothering him too much.

However, this doesn't necessarily rule him fully healthy going forward. LeBron James injured his ankle in the previous contest and stayed in the game, but was forced to sit out this one to ensure a full recovery.
